MaixCube 集成摄像头、TF卡槽、用户按键、TFT显示屏、锂电池、扬声器麦克、扩展接口等, 用户可使用 Maix Cube 轻松搭建一款人脸识别门禁系统, 同时还预留开发调试接口, 也能将其作为一款功能强大的 AI 学习开发板.
Maix Cube 对用户开放了两个高度扩展的接口: SP-MOD 与 Grove 接口,
用户可以很方便的进行 DIY
SP-MOD 即为 sipeed module, simplify PMOD, super module
接口 | 接口描述 |
---|---|
SP-MODE 接口描述 | ![]() |
硬件接口 | ![]() |
Grove 接口的线缆有 4 种颜色, 用户可以根据颜色快速区别
--- | 颜色 | 描述 |
---|---|---|
pin 1 | 黄色 | (例如, I2C Grove Connectors上的SCL) |
pin 2 | 白色 | (例如, I2C Grove Connectors上的SDA) |
pin 3 | 红色 | VCC (所有的Grove接口红色都是VCC) |
pin 4 | 黑色 | GND (所有的Grove接口红色都是GND) |
Grove模块主要有 4 种接口:
pin | Function | Note |
---|---|---|
pin1 | Dn | 第一个数字输入 |
pin2 | Dn+1 | 第二个数字输入 |
pin3 | VCC | 供电引脚 5V/3.3V |
pin4 | GND | 地 |
pin | Function | Note |
---|---|---|
pin1 | An | 第一个模拟输入 |
pin2 | An+1 | 第二个模拟输入 |
pin3 | VCC | 供电引脚 5V/3.3V |
pin4 | GND | 地 |
pin | Function | Note |
---|---|---|
pin1 | RX | 串行接收 |
pin2 | TX | 串行发送 |
pin3 | VCC | 供电引脚 5V/3.3V |
pin4 | GND | 地 |
Grove I2C:
有许多类型的 I2C Grove 传感器可用.MaixAmigo 上的 Grove 只支持 3.3V 传感器
Grove I2C 连接器具有标准布局.引脚 1 是SCL信号, 引脚 2 是SDA信号
pin | Function | Note |
---|---|---|
pin1 | SCL | I2C 时钟 |
pin2 | SDA | I2C 数据 |
pin3 | VCC | 供电引脚, 5V/3.3V |
pin4 | GND | 地 |
MaixCube 板载 I2C 传感器/IC
IC | 设备 id | I2C 地址(7位地址) |
---|---|---|
ES8374 | 0x08 | 0x10 |
MSA301 | 0x13 | 0x26 |
AXP173 | 0x68 | 0x34 |
K210 芯片基本参数 | |
---|---|
内核 | RISC-V Dual Core 64bit, with FPU |
主频 | 400MHz (可超频至500MHz) |
SRAM | 内置8M Byte |
摄像头帧率 | OV7740/QVGA@60fps/VGA@30fps |
语音识别 | 离线语音识别,声场 |
网络模型 |
|
深度学习框架 | 支持TensorFlow \ Keras \ Darknet \ Caffe 等主流框架 |
外设 | FPIOA、 UART、 GPIO、 SPI、 I2C、I2S、 TIMER |
硬件加速单元 |
|
开发板参数 | |
---|---|
板载资源 |
|
板载接口 |
|
尺寸 | 40*40*18.6mm |
供电电压 | USB-type或内部锂电池(200mAh) |
软件开发 | |
---|---|
软件环境 | MaixPy(microPython) |
开发环境 | MaixPy IDE、PlatformlO IDE、Arduino IDE等 |
编程语言 | C,MicroPython |
Sipeed-Maix-Cube 资料下载:Sipeed-Maix-Cube
Sipeed-Maix-Cube 规格书下载:Sipeed-Maix-Cube
Sipeed-Maix-Cube 原理图下载:Sipeed-Maix-Cube.pdf
I2C总线是由Philips公司开发的一种简单、双向二线制同步串行总线。它只需要两根线即可在连接于总线上的器件之间传送信息。
这篇文档以 SIPEED MaixDuino 的使用为示例说明,并且大部分内容通用于 K210 系列开发板,可供购入 K210 系列顾客参考使用。
本文从芯片架构,到开发板选型,再到软件开发环境的搭建介绍了关于K210的基础ABC,这块KPU其实有很多有意思的应用,我会在后面的文章中进行更多介绍,包括SDK中各个模块的使用方式,以及如何将自己的AI模型部署到K210上面去运行。
勘智K210采用RISC-V处理器架构,具备视听一体、自主IP核与可编程能力强三大特点,支持机器视觉与机器听觉多模态识别,可广泛应用于智能家居、智能园区、智能能耗和智能农业等场景。
MaixPy 是将 Micropython 移植到 K210 的一个项目,不但支持 MCU 常规操作, 还集成了硬件加速的 AI 机器视觉和麦克风阵列相关的算法。